@@ -334,8 +334,18 @@ static int pwm_fan_probe(struct platform_device *pdev)
ctx->pwm_value = MAX_PWM;
- /* Set duty cycle to maximum allowed and enable PWM output */
pwm_init_state(ctx->pwm, &state);
+ /*
+ * __set_pwm assumes that MAX_PWM * (period - 1) fits into an unsigned
+ * long. Check this here to prevent the fan running at a too low
+ * frequency.
+ */
+ if (state.period > ULONG_MAX / MAX_PWM + 1) {
+ dev_err(dev, "Configured period too big\n");
+ return -EINVAL;
+ }
+
+ /* Set duty cycle to maximum allowed and enable PWM output */
state.duty_cycle = ctx->pwm->args.period - 1;
state.enabled = true;
